SAEDNEWS: Commander of the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ps During the Iran–Iraq War: Future Negotiations Conditional on Iran’s Terms and Resistance
According to the political desk of the Saednews news agency, Major General Mohsen Rezaei, former commander of the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ps during the Sacred Defense period and a member of the Expediency Discernment Council, commented on the Lebanon ceasefire set to begin tomorrow morning:
He wrote that the resistance of Hezbollah fighters and multi-dimensional pressure from Iran (including the Strait of Hormuz leverage and suspension of negotiations) have led to the imposition of a ceasefire on the “Zionist-American enemy” in Lebanon. He added that both the Lebanese government and Donald Trump are attempting to present this ceasefire as their own initiative.
He further stated that any future negotiations will be contingent upon Iran’s conditions and those of the resistance.
